Again I have NO idea where to put this thread so lets hope this is it.

I looked at my site this morning and this is what I see:

Warning: mysql_connect(): Too many connections in /home/content/d/a/z/dazedangels/html/oscMAX2/catalog/admin/includes/functions/database.php on line 19
Unable to connect to database server!

I haven't changed anything in months. I was just editing items last night and everything was fine when I went to bed.

All other databases on the site seem to be fine. I'm allowed 10 and I've used 9.

I'm just threwing things our there because I have NO idea what that means.

I need this up and running!

Yep, that is a message that is telling you godaddy's mysql server is overloaded and not allowing any more connections at the moment .

Doing a google search on the error message would be your best bet to learn about the different error messages you see...
